Systematic quantitative analysis of desiccated human paleofeces from two rockshelters in eastern Kentucky has yielded new evidence for early agricultural diet in eastern North America. Results indicate that native cultigens (including sumpweed, sunflower, and chenopod) were sometimes significant dietary constituents as early as ca. 1000 B.C., at least a millennium before agricultural economies became widespread across the region. However, variability in the quantity and frequency of cultigen remains suggests a dietary role that was somewhat limited compared to the practices of later Woodland period farmers. The predictions of foraging theory suggest that the utilization of cultigens would have been most advantageous in spring and summer (when many other foods were scarce) or in years of poor production by nut-bearing trees. The causal link between food storage and the development of food production in eastern Kentucky receives some empirical support and warrants further investigation.

AbstractAntiquarians of the nineteenth century referred to the largest monumental constructions in eastern North America as pyramids, but this usage faded among archaeologists by the mid-twentieth century. Pauketat (2007) has reintroduced the term pyramid to describe the larger, Mississippian-period (A.D. 1050 to 1550) mounds of the interior of the continent, recognizing recent studies that demonstrate the complexity of their construction. Such recognition is lacking for earlier mounds and for those constructed of shell. We describe the recent identification of stepped pyramids of shell from the Roberts Island Complex, located on the central Gulf Coast of Florida and dating to the terminal Late Woodland period, A.D. 800 to 1050, thus recognizing the sophistication of monument construction in an earlier time frame, using a different construction material, and taking an alternative form.

The sea cliffs at Joggins, Nova Scotia, are the most extensive and continuous Carboniferous section in eastern North America. Although the section has been considered to have formed within a nonmarine depositional basin, paleobiological information indicates that parts of the section were deposited in brackish water. The occurrence of a trace-fossil assemblage, which includes Cochlichnus, Kouphichnium, and Treptichnus, is part of an assemblage of biogenic structures that apparently reflects paleodeposition within fluvial systems that may have experienced distal marine influences. Presence of agglutinated foraminifera characteristic of brackish-water environments supports this interpretation. This information provides new evidence of brackish-water conditions at Joggins such as those now being widely recognized in other Carboniferous coal-bearing sections.

Despite the fact that small seeds are often inefficient to exploit, they are consumed and sometimes cultivated in many parts of the world, including eastern North America. Foraging models predict that seeds are likely to be utilized only if preferred resources become scarce, or if their own profitability is increased through processes such as domestication or technological innovation. Ethnographic, experimental, and nutritional studies of the small grains used prehistorically in eastern North America suggest that they offered low rates of return (measured as energy per unit time spent) compared to many alternative resources. These estimates rely on the assumption that some degree of post-harvest processing was required to make seed foods palatable and nutritious. That this assumption is reasonable is supported by archaeological and archaeobotanical evidence from rockshelters in eastern Kentucky. Resource stress and technological innovation are unlikely explanations for the adoption of such low-ranking resources in this region around 3500 B.P. However, estimation of return rates does not take account of the lowered significance of time costs in the winter season, when seed processing could take place with little competition from other productive tasks. The timing of the adoption of small seeds also reflects historical factors such as spatial distribution of plant populations and habitats.

During the Middle Woodland period in eastern North America, modified human skulls are interjected into a broader pattern of "trophy"-artifact manufacture. Interpretations of these human trophies have resulted in a polarity of opinion-that they are the remains of (1) revered ancestors, or (2) defeated enemies. Both previous investigations of the problem support exclusively the "revered-ancestor" interpretation. Results of the present study, which makes use of a six-site Ohio Hopewell sample and stylistic and biological analyses, do not support this position, and are seen as reflecting a competitive component in Hopewell society.

Using measurements from archaeological achenes of the extinct North American cultigen marshelder (Iva annua var. macrocarpa [S.F. Blake] R.C. Jackson), we quantitatively explore patterns of variation of fruit length and width across mid-continental North America. Linear regression shows that while achene length and width increase significantly over time (length: p-value<0.0001, b=-126.04, r2=0.1037, width: p-value<0.0001, b=-230.85, r2=0.0964), overall, regions tend to show more variation. A high incidence of phenotypic variation among domesticated marshelder as measured by coefficient of variation may be a result of introgression with wild stands. An ANOVA Tukey post-hoc analysis of archaeological site samples resulted in homogeneous subsets which correspond to region with some overlap, interpreted as a cline. These results and the low numbers of wild-sized achenes in archaeological marshelder samples of eastern Kentucky support human introduction of domesticated marshelder into this region. Marshelder in the archaeological record reflects the long-standing mixed economies of hunting-gathering and agriculture used by indigenous communities of eastern North America.

Specimens of desiccated Chenopodium berlandieri ssp. jonesianum from Cloudsplitter and Newt Kash Rock-shelters in Menifee County, eastern Kentucky yielded accelerator dates of 3450 ± 150 B.P. and 3400 ± 150 B.P., respectively, extending the known age of this prehistoric domesticate by 1,000 years.

Darwin first recognized the importance of episodic intercontinental dispersal in the establishment of worldwide biotic diversity. Faunal exchange across the Bering Land Bridge is a major example of such dispersal. Here, we demonstrate with mitochondrial DNA evidence that three independent dispersal events from Asia to North America are the source for almost all lizard taxa found in continental eastern North America. Two other dispersal events across Beringia account for observed diversity among North American ranid frogs, one of the most species-rich groups of frogs in eastern North America. The contribution of faunal elements from Asia via dispersal across Beringia is a dominant theme in the historical assembly of the eastern North American herpetofauna.

Past research on the development of Archaic ideological complexity in eastern North America has focused on ritualism and ceremony related to mortuary behaviors, with less attention to ritualism within what is commonly thought of as domestic contexts without overt mortuary ceremonialism or monumental architecture. The recent discovery of puddled clay architecture and associated features at the Burrell Orchard site (33LN15) in northeast Ohio provides new evidence of significant, nonmortuary ritualism within Late Archaic basecamp contexts. That such activity took place alongside normal seasonal subsistence tasks is revealed by thick midden deposits containing abundant burned rock, nutshell, and deer bone. The many bone and stone tool deposits associated with the floors, along with the labor-intensive nature of the clay construction for what appears to have been individually short-term use, support the interpretation of these features as shrines possibly associated with hunting ritualism.
